Oxford Moor is a small, gated enclave in Windermere, where large lots, mature landscaping, and a quiet setting draw buyers who want space without giving up proximity to everything Central Florida offers. It sits in good company alongside communities like Keenes Pointe and Isleworth, and the location puts Walt Disney World about 20 minutes away and downtown Orlando roughly 25. Assigned schools include Windermere High, Bridgewater Middle, and Windermere Elementary, which keeps families in the mix here.
This is a thin, high-end market, so buyers should move with intent. There's currently just one active listing, priced at $1,289,000, and over the past year only two homes sold, at a median of $1,655,000. With sellers averaging 87% of asking, there's real room to negotiate — but limited inventory means when the right home appears, you act. Nearby options in Summerport and Lakeside Village can widen the search if timing matters.

Straight answers
Oxford Moor FAQs
Is Oxford Moor a good place to live?+
It's a strong fit for buyers who want a gated, spacious setting close to Orlando's attractions, with Disney about 20 minutes away and downtown around 25. Homes feed into Windermere High, Bridgewater Middle, and Windermere Elementary, and the community sits near well-regarded neighbors like Keenes Pointe. It's quiet, established, and family-oriented.
Is Oxford Moor expensive?+
Yes — this is a luxury enclave, with the single active listing priced at $1,289,000 and homes over the past year selling at a median of $1,655,000. Every current listing sits in the $1M-plus range, so budget accordingly. For a wider price spread, it's worth also looking at Summerport.
What do homes cost in Oxford Moor?+
The active listing is $1,289,000, or about $340 per square foot on a roughly 3,793-square-foot home. Over the last 12 months, two homes closed at a median sold price of $1,655,000. Pricing varies with lot, waterfront, and finishes.
How is the market in Oxford Moor?+
It's a low-volume market — just one active listing and two sales over the past year — so inventory is tight. Sellers have averaged 87% of asking, which points to real negotiating room when a home does come up. Broader Windermere inventory can supplement a search here.
What about HOA fees and property taxes?+
The median HOA runs about $183 per month, covering the gated community's shared upkeep. Property taxes come in around $13,264 per year, in line with the neighborhood's price point. Both are worth factoring into your monthly carrying cost.
